As of February 20, 2025, there are no credible reports confirming that forward Norchad Omier has accepted an $89 million deal to depart from Baylor University’s basketball program. Omier, who transferred to Baylor from Miami, has been a significant contributor to the Bears’ performance this season. However, the figure mentioned appears inconsistent with standard contracts in collegiate athletics, as college athletes typically do not receive such high compensation.
It’s important to note that while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) deals have allowed college athletes to earn compensation, the amounts are generally far less than the figure stated. For instance, top college basketball players have NIL valuations in the range of $1 million to $5 million.
Given the lack of official announcements or credible sources supporting this claim, it is advisable to approach this information with caution.
